dignifying

[美國]/ˈdɪɡnɪfaɪɪŋ/
[英國]/ˈdɪɡnɪfaɪɪŋ/
詞頻: 非常高

中文釋義

v.使顯得威嚴;使高貴;使顯赫;誇大

例句

his speech was dignifying to the entire community.

他的演講使整個社區感到受尊重。

she found a dignifying way to address the issue.

她找到了一種有尊嚴的方式來處理這個問題。

the award was a dignifying recognition of her hard work.

這個獎項是對她辛勤工作的尊重。

he believes in dignifying all forms of labor.

他相信尊重所有形式的勞動。

they aimed at dignifying the role of teachers in society.

他們旨在提升教師在社會中的地位。

the project is focused on dignifying the lives of the underprivileged.

該項目專注於提升弱勢羣體的生活。

her actions were dignifying and inspiring to many.

她的行爲對許多人來說是有尊嚴且鼓舞人心的。

we should always be dignifying towards our elders.

我們應該始終對長輩保持尊重。

the ceremony was dignifying and full of tradition.

儀式莊重而富有傳統。

he wrote a dignifying letter to express his gratitude.

他寫了一封莊重的信來表達他的感激之情。
